Introduction

Max-EDTA is a prescription medication that contains the active ingredient Disodium edetate. It is available in injectable form and is commonly used in the treatment of certain heavy metal poisoning, such as lead or mercury poisoning.

Uses

Max-EDTA is primarily prescribed to treat heavy metal poisoning. It works by binding to heavy metal ions in the body and facilitating their elimination through urine. This medication is often used in conjunction with other treatments, such as chelation therapy, to effectively remove toxic metals from the body.

Mechanism of Action

Disodium edetate, the active ingredient in Max-EDTA, works by forming stable complexes with heavy metal ions in the body. These complexes are then excreted through urine, aiding in the removal of toxic metals from the system. By chelating with heavy metals, Disodium edetate helps reduce their harmful effects on various organs and tissues.

Precautions

Before using Max-EDTA, inform your healthcare provider about any known allergies to Disodium edetate or any other medications. Additionally, disclose any medical conditions you have, especially kidney or liver disease, as these may affect the safety and effectiveness of the medication.

Max-EDTA is contraindicated in patients with severe renal impairment or anuria (absence of urine production). It should be used with caution in patients with mild to moderate renal impairment.
